Eligibility
International students are eligible to apply for this scholarship.

Entrance Requirements:
Applicants must meet the following criteria:

1). Applicants must normally hold an approved bachelor degree or equivalent qualification from a recognised tertiary institution.

2). The Master of Public Policy and Management consists of 72 units.
A full 18 units of credit is granted to applicants who have completed our 18-unit Graduate Certificate in Public Sector Management or the 18-unit Graduate Certificate in Public Policy or an approved equivalent. Students who have completed one of the Graduate Certificates or an approved equivalent but not an undergraduate degree must have achieved an acceptable GPA.
Up to 36 units credit may be granted to applicants who have completed our Graduate Diploma in Public Administration or an approved equivalent with an acceptable GPA.

Scholarship benefits
The 15% scholarship is a 15% reduction in course fees for completion of the Master of Public Policy and Management. If accepted into the program, the scholarship will be automatically applied for you.

The Flinders University of South Australia, commonly referred to as Flinders University, is a public university in Adelaide, South Australia. Founded in 1966, it was named in honour of navigator Matthew Flinders, who explored and surveyed the South Australian coastline in the early 19th century. The university has established a reputation as a leading research institution with a devotion to innovation.
